Tài liệu Image Optimizer

Chuyển đổi hình ảnh sang WebP hoặc AVIF ngay lập tức và phục vụ chúng từ CDN 12 thành phố. Plugin WordPress dễ dàng tích hợp, tiện ích mở rộng Plesk hoặc REST API.

https://image-optimizer.api.jetweb.appREST APILưu trữ tại EU

Tổng quan

API Image Optimizer chấp nhận URL hình ảnh nguồn (hoặc tải lên) và trả về phiên bản tối ưu hóa ở định dạng WebP hoặc AVIF. Các URL hình ảnh hiện có trên trang web của bạn vẫn hoạt động — trình tối ưu hóa viết lại chúng một cách lười biếng qua plugin WordPress hoặc qua quy tắc biên trên CDN của bạn.

Khởi động nhanh

Gửi yêu cầu POST với URL nguồn và định dạng đích. Phản hồi chứa URL CDN đã tối ưu hóa mà bạn có thể nhúng vào HTML của mình.

bash
curl -X POST https://image-optimizer.api.jetweb.app/api/optimize \
  -H "Authorization: Bearer YOUR_API_KEY" \
  -H "Content-Type: application/json" \
  -d '{
    "url": "https://example.com/photo.jpg",
    "format": "webp",
    "quality": 80
  }'

Xác thực

Mọi endpoint API đều yêu cầu token Bearer. Tạo token trong bảng điều khiển tại mục "API Keys" cho sản phẩm tương ứng. Giữ token ở phía máy chủ — không bao giờ commit chúng vào kho lưu trữ công khai hoặc đưa vào bundle frontend.

bash
Authorization: Bearer YOUR_API_KEY

Endpoints

Base URL: https://image-optimizer.api.jetweb.app

POST
/api/optimize
Tối ưu hóa một hình ảnh. Chấp nhận url, format (webp/avif), quality (1–100) và width/height tùy chọn.
GET
/api/history
Liệt kê các hình ảnh đã tối ưu hóa gần đây cho tài khoản đã xác thực.
GET
/api/usage
Trả về hạn mức sử dụng hiện tại và dung lượng còn lại cho tài khoản đã xác thực.
GET
/api/cdn/:domain/:path
Truy xuất trực tiếp tài sản đã tối ưu hóa từ CDN. Hữu ích cho việc kiểm tra; khách hàng sản xuất nên nhúng URL CDN đã trả về.

Tích hợp

Cài đặt plugin WordPress từ wordpress.org hoặc kích hoạt tiện ích mở rộng Plesk. Đối với các ngăn xếp tùy chỉnh, gọi trực tiếp REST API — mọi thư viện khách hàng có thể POST JSON đều hoạt động.